# Calendar Sync — Conflict Limits

When Tidemark Calendar detects conflicting edits, it retries merges with exponential backoff before flagging the event for manual review. Support should know that retry budgets are per-account, not per-event, so a single noisy calendar can exhaust the quota. Before escalating, compare the account's counters against these defaults:

tuning table, faduf-baduf:
PRIORITIES = {
    "ulavan": 191,
    "silys": 750,
    "goriel": 238,
    "kelmir": 66,
    "wendor": 432,
}

Alert: REPORT_SORT_INSTABILITY

This alert fires when the Ledgerview report builder produces differing row orders for identical queries, detected by the nightly checksum comparison. The usual cause is a sort key with ties resolved nondeterministically across shards. Treat it as a correctness issue, not cosmetic, since exports are diffed downstream. Triage steps are on the page below.

operations page: https://confluence.tolvaqsys.corp/spaces/pages/pages/6e787158f507

**Vendor note: Inkmill markdown pipeline**

Rendering for Parchway docs is outsourced to Inkmill under an annual contract, renewing each March. They handle sanitization and PDF export; we own the upload queue. SLA: 4-hour response on rendering failures. Escalate only after two failed retries. Their support desk is reachable at the address below.

billing contact of hahaf-baguf = zorael.tammir.jorius@sivrelhq.internal

Welcome to the Relay team at Quartermile Systems. Your first ticket will likely touch the websocket reconnect bug in Pondview: after a network blip, clients reconnect but skip the session resume handshake, duplicating subscriptions. The fix lives behind the reconnect_v2 flag. To access the staging vault where the flag config is stored, use the passphrase below.

unlock words, yagep-fahof: belix-rusvan-casdor-gorox-aldath-norael-istix-quenael-fraeth-silael

Runbook: Pallox pick-list optimizer, release cut. Reviewer checklist: confirm route-scoring weights match staging config, rerun the bin-sequencing benchmark, and verify no regression over 2% on median pick time. Reject if the Hollowmere warehouse simulation fails. Freeze merges once the candidate branch is cut. Tag only after both approvals land. Push the tagged build to the fulfillment cluster, then sign the artifact using the deploy key shown below.

rollout seal: bky3_Zik